DDoS(分布式拒绝服务)攻击是一种常见的网络攻击手段,通过大量的流量或请求淹没目标服务器,使其无法处理正常的请求,最终导致服务中断。因此,配置有效的服务器防御机制是每个网络管理员和企业不可忽视的重要环节。以下将详细解析如何有效配置服务器防御DDoS攻击的最佳实践。
一、理解DDoS攻击的类型
在制定防御策略之前,首先需要了解DDoS攻击的不同类型。常见的DDoS攻击包括:
-
流量攻击:
通过大量无用流量填满带宽,例如UDP洪水攻击、ICMP洪水攻击等。 -
协议攻击:
通过占用连接资源来耗尽服务器的处理能力,如SYN洪水。 -
应用层攻击:
伪装成正常用户请求,针对应用程序发起攻击,例如HTTP洪水。
了解这些攻击类型有助于在防御过程中选择合适的策略和工具。
二、提高网络基础设施的冗余性
在服务器配置中,提高冗余性是抵御DDoS攻击的重要措施之一。可以从以下几个方面进行考虑:
-
负载均衡:
通过负载均衡器分发到多个服务器,确保在某一台服务器受到攻击时,其他服务器可以继续提供服务。 -
CDN(内容分发网络):
使用CDN可以将流量分散到多个节点上,当出现攻击时,可以有效减轻主服务器的压力。 -
冗余连接:
配置多个网络连接,避免单点故障,使得在某个线路受到攻击时,流量可以通过其他线路继续传输。
冗余性不仅可以提高抗DDoS的能力,还能增强整体网络的可靠性。
三、部署DDoS防护解决方案
在云计算和网络安全服务不断发展的今天,各种DDoS防护服务应运而生。合理选择DDoS防护解决方案可以有效降低风险:
-
硬件防火墙:
部署强大的硬件防火墙,可以提前识别并过滤掉恶意流量。 -
云端DDoS防护服务:
服务提供商通常会有专门应对DDoS攻击的系统,可以在攻击发生时自动接管流量并进行处理。 -
软件防火墙和IPS:
使用专门的防病毒软件和入侵防护系统,进一步提高网络的防御能力。
在选择防护解决方案时,企业需要结合自身的规模、需求和预算,选择最合适的方案。
四、配合实时监控与响应机制
为了提高抵御DDoS攻击的应变能力,实时监控和快速响应至关重要。建议采取以下措施:
-
流量监控:
利用流量监控工具实时观察网络流量,及时发现异常流量并做好记录。 -
应急响应计划:
建立完善的应急响应机制,包括针对不同类型攻击的快速响应流程,确保能够迅速开启应对措施。 -
定期演练:
定期进行DDoS攻击模拟演练,检验和提升团队的应急处理能力。
在确保网络安全的同时,能够大幅度降低因攻击导致的停机时间和损失。
五、增强服务器的安全配置
增强服务器自身的安全配置,也是防止DDoS攻击的重要手段。可以通过以下方式进行设置:
-
限制连接数:
限制来自同一IP的最大连接数,有效减小异地恶意流量的影响。 -
优化服务器配置:
对服务器的性能进行调优,使其能够在受到攻击时仍能保持较高的处理能力。 -
使用CAPTCHA:
对某些需要用户交互的操作设置验证,防止自动化攻击。
这些措施有助于提升服务器的安全性,降低被DDoS攻击影响的可能性。
六、定期进行安全测试
最后,定期进行渗透测试和安全评估也是保障网络安全的重要手段。可以通过以下步骤进行:
-
漏洞扫描:
定期对系统和应用进行漏洞扫描,发现并修复潜在的攻击入口。 -
模拟攻击:
进行渗透测试,模拟DDoS攻击,评估现有防护措施的有效性。 -
更新安全策略:
根据测试结果更新和优化安全防护策略,确保在面对新型攻击时具备良好的应对能力。
通过不断的测试和优化,能够有效提升整体网络的抗DDoS能力。
总结
防范DDoS攻击的最佳实践不仅依赖于先进的技术工具,还需要合理的配置与管理。由于DDoS攻击具有爆发性和不可预见性,加大对服务器的防护力度并不断优化网络安全策略,才能在面对各种威胁时保持良好的服务可用性。这也是企业在数字化转型过程中,必须重视的关键问题之一。